New Book on Tommy Dorsey to Come Out Nov. 1

Peter Levinson’s biography on jazz giant Tommy Dorsey, Tommy Dorsey: Livin’ in a Great Big Way, is due out Nov. 1, just in time for the Nov. 19 centennial of Dorsey’s birth and the release of Bluebird/Legacy’s three-CD box set entitled The Sentimental Gentleman of Swing.

Levinson was first exposed to Dorsey’s music as a student at the University of Virginia, where Dorsey performed in 1953. This well-researched biography encompasses nearly every aspect of the life of one of the greatest Big Band era leaders in depth and makes extensive use of interviews with the musicians who knew him.; including his surprising cause of death.
